Kelly McClary Obituary

Funeral services for Kelly McClary, 64, of Portales, will be held at 10:00 AM, Sat., April 4, 2026, in the Wheeler Mortuary Chapel with Jimmy Rowlett and Steve Fleischman officiating.
Burial will follow in the Portales Cemetery with Jose Hernandez, Humberto Hernandez, Tony Terrazas, Damian Lozano, Charles Morris and James Kendrick serving as pallbearers. The family will receive guests at Wheeler Mortuary on Friday evening, April 3, 2026 from 6:00 PM - 8:00 PM.
Kelly Dean McClary was born Jan. 12, 1962, in Amarillo, TX to the home of Lynell Ruth (Skelton) and David Stanton McClary and passed from this life on the afternoon of Mar. 29, 2026, at his home in Portales. Kelly's family moved to Portales when he a young boy. At the age of 16, he and his friend Woody left school to work in Flagstaff, AZ with Woody's Uncle Dave in his concrete business. He soon returned to Portales, and on Feb. 28, 1981, at the First Baptist Church, he was married to Sheryl Denise Heflin.
For a very brief time he worked at the Swift Processing Plant in Dumas, TX before coming back to Portales. He first worked as a roofer, but due to the unpredictability of roofing jobs, he soon left and went to work at for his father-in-law at Heflin Lumber Co. Beginning in 1987, he and his father-in-law contracted with the US Postal Service to build handicap ramps for Post Offices throughout the surrounding states. In 1997, he began as a sub-contractor at the ABENGOA ethanol plant. In 2007,he and his father-in-law along with his brother Brien built the lagoon for the DFA plant west of Portales.
He and his wife Purchased Pat's Drive-In in 2000 and later sold it to their daughter. For a number of years, Kelly, along with his father-in-law, Don Heflin and Tommy Heflin were in partnership in Portales Concrete. He later purchased Tommy's interest, and in October of 2025, he sold the business. In 2018, he and his wife opened A Little Old A Little New event venue on Highway 70, and more recently opened a second venue on Main St.
Kelly loved to be busy and just enjoyed his work. In addition to his various business interests and his family, he loved classic cars. The favorite one of his collection was a 1969 Roadrunner.
Kelly is survived by Sheryl, his wife of 45 years of their home; two daughters and a son-in-law, Ashley and James Kendrick and Kassey McClary of Portales; five grandchildren, Trendon, Kelsey and Brooke Kendrick and Davian and Brielle Lucero; his mother, Lynell McClary of
Portales; a brother and sister-in-law, Brien and Stephanie McClary of Portales; a sister and brother-in-law, Lynlea and Steve Fleischman of Morgantown, IN, step siblings John and Ladonna Schwab and John and Lori Danforth, his mother-in-law, Pauline Heflin and two sisters-in-law, Paula Heflin and Patti Heflin and her companion Alfonso Gomez all of Portales. He was preceded in death by his father in 2003, and his father-in-law, Don Heflin in 2023 as well as by his maternal grandparents, Ruth and P. W. Skelton, his paternal grandmother, Willie McClary and an uncle, Jim Balfour and a cousin, Scott Balfour.
